ST. LOUIS, MOThrottleNet, Inc., one of the fastest-growing IT firms in St. Louis, is proud to announce that it has achieved Elite Partner Status with Datto, a global leader in backup, disaster recovery (BDR), and intelligent business continuity (IBC) solutions.

This achievement places ThrottleNet among an exclusive group of IT providers nationwide recognized for delivering exceptional BDR solutions and customer service. Datto’s Elite Partner designation is the highest level of partnership attainable—reserved for top-performing organizations that demonstrate proven success, advanced technical expertise, and an ongoing commitment to business continuity excellence.

Why Backup and Disaster Recovery Matters More Than Ever

Today’s businesses face unprecedented risks—from ransomware attacks to natural disasters and human error. Without a robust BDR plan, even a few hours of downtime can result in lost revenue, damaged reputation, and potential regulatory penalties.

About Datto: A Global Leader in BDR Solutions

Founded in 2007, Datto is widely recognized as an industry leader in backup, disaster recovery, and business continuity technologies. Its robust product portfolio includes:

  • Datto SIRIS: Enterprise-grade BDR platform for complete data protection.
  • Datto ALTO: Designed for small business environments seeking affordable continuity.
  • Datto G Series: Powerful hardware for on-premise and hybrid backup.
  • Datto GenISIS: Comprehensive IBC (Intelligent Business Continuity) solution for large organizations.

With a presence across North America and Europe, Datto continues to empower managed service providers like ThrottleNet to deliver enterprise-level protection at small-business scale.
